The National Monuments Service's description

Rectangular-shaped fort (LI031-093----) with possible souterrain described by O'Kelly (1942-3, 233) as following; 'This consists of a rectangular platform on the edge of which there may have been a bank. The latter has disappeared completely on the north side. In the S.W. quadrant there is an elongated hollow which may be a collapsed souterrain'.
